In this episode, Dave and Andrew consider one of the few concertos to win the Pulitzer Prize, this time for an instrument whose sound some critics claimed grew "tiresome." Will they agree? And what famous composer's music is quoted in the piece?

If you'd like more information about Christopher Rouse, we recommend:

  1. This interview with Joe Alessi mentioned in the episode.
  2. R. Burkhardt Reiter's 2005 dissertation, Symmetry and Narrative in Christopher Rouse's Trombone Concerto with white space waiting (an original composition for chamber orchestra)
  3. Laurie Shulman's article, "Christopher Rouse: An Overview" in Tempo, no. 199 (1997): 2-8.
